Sen. Mark Warner has pressed DHS for answers about a reported sharp decline in CISA election-security support ahead of the 2026 midterms, citing reduced training, intelligence-sharing, staffing and potential elimination of program funding. Warner requested records of CISA election-related activities since January 2025 and asked whether agency personnel were involved in specific FBI actions tied to election systems; the letter warns that cuts could leave states more vulnerable to cyber threats and foreign interference.
